Creamy Cheese & Cherry Pie 3 cups Rice Crispies, crushed 1/4 cup sugar 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on 1/2 cup butter, melted 4 (3-ounce) packages cream cheese, softened 2 eggs 1 teaspoon vanilla 1/3 cup sugar 1 teaspoon lemon juice 1 (8-ounce) sour cream 2 tablespoon sugar 1 (1-pound 5-ounce) can cherry pie filling 1 teaspoon lemon juice In a bowl combine the Rice Crispies, 1/4-cup sugar and cinnamon with the butter. Mix well. Press firmly in a 9-inch pie pan to form a crust, and set aside. In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th. Add the eggs, vanilla, 1/3-cup sugar and 1-teaspoon lemon juice, mixing until well combined. Pour the mixture into the crust. Bake at 375-degrees for approximately 20 minutes, or until set. Meanwhile, in a small bowl stir together the sour cream and 2-tablespoon sugar. Remove the pie from the oven and spread the sour cream mixture over the top. Return to the oven, bake for an additional 5 minutes. Remove the pie from oven and allow to cool. In a bowl combine the pie filling and the remaining 1-teaspoon lemon juice. Mix well. Spread the mixture over the top of the cooled pie. Refrigerate for a few hours prior to serving. Use a deep dish pie plate and spray the plate first with Pam or one of the other spray's.Comes out easier Jay
